As a coffee enthusiast and Disneyland fan, I recently had the chance to taste the Mud Cake Cold Brew at Troubadour Tavern, and it truly impressed me. This cold brew is unlike any other iced coffee I’ve tried in the park. The rich, smooth coffee blends perfectly with the malted milk topper, creating a creamy texture that complements the chocolate flavors wonderfully. The hit of fudgy brownie bits and colorful sprinkles adds a delightful crunch and sweetness, making this drink feel like a decadent dessert in beverage form. For anyone who loves dessert drinks or chocolate, this cold brew is a must-try. It offers a unique twist compared to the traditional Black Caf from Galaxy’s Edge, which for a long time was my favorite. What I particularly enjoyed was how the balance between the coffee’s bitterness and the sweetness of the toppings kept the drink from being overpowering. It’s indulgent but still refreshing enough to enjoy while exploring the park. I also noticed some other intriguing offerings, like the Banoffee Pie Cold Brew with butterscotch and the cold brew with banana foam and chocolate shavings, which I’m eager to try next.
